The Multimedia Lab was created out of a partnership between the Public Health Library & Informatics Division and ITCS to support the creation of multimedia projects by SPH faculty, staff, and students in order to enhance their teaching, learning, and research at the University of Michigan.

The Multimedia Lab is located at the east end of the Public Health Library.

Available Resources

The Multimedia Lab has four Pentium 4 Dell Optiplex GX270 PCs. In addition to the software listed on the Campus Computing Sites Available Software page, the following software is loaded on these computers:

  • Net Drive 4.1
  • Unsealed 4.0.1.4.2

Also available in the lab:

  • Two Fujitsu 4220C2 Scanners
  • Three LaserJet 4300dtn Printers
